A special episode of Discover Wisconsin will feature Aquatic Invasive Species threats and control efforts throughout Wisconsin. This television program is supported by a grant from the Wisconsin Coastal Management Program to the Great Lakes Indian Fish and Wildlife Commission (GLIFWC). GLIFWC provided matching funds and significant technical assistance for the production. This program is also part of Invasive Species Awareness Month, sponsored by the Wisconsin Invasive Species Council.

With over 15,000 lakes and nearly 14,000 miles of rivers and streams, it's no wonder why visitors flock to Wisconsin for endless opportunities on the water. From charter fishing for a trophy size catch on the great lakes; to creating lifetime memories with family and friends at a lakeside resort, visitors depend on clean healthy waters when choosing Wisconsin for their vacation getaway. In this special episode of Discover Wisconsin, we will be taking a look at the problem of aquatic invasive species. These foreign plants and animals crowd out native species and transform delicate aquatic ecosystems. We'll learn about some of the most significant threats to Wisconsin waters. We will also show you what is being done in Wisconsin to control present infestation. Lastly well introduce you to volunteers who are working together to prevent the spread of invasives into other waterways. Come discover why maintaining our resources for the future is so important to Wisconsin.
